Market Overview
Dickinson, TX is strategically located between League City and Texas City and continues to benefit from the southward expansion of the Houston metro area. The area has experienced growth in residential development, medical offices, retail services, and commercial activity supporting the Bay Area workforce.
Recent improvements along the FM 517 corridor have enhanced connectivity and increased interest in commercial and mixed-use redevelopment opportunities. With favorable demographics, strong regional access, and a pro-growth environment, Dickinson remains a compelling market for investors, owner-users, and developers.
